    Redigo

    Redigo

    Go client for Redis

    ...In the future, functions will be added for creating sharded and other types of connections. Connections support one concurrent caller to the Receive method and one concurrent caller to the Send and Flush methods. No other concurrency is supported including concurrent calls to the Do and Close methods. For full concurrent access to Redis, use the thread-safe Pool to get, use and release a connection from within a goroutine.

    Transporter

    Transporter

    Sync data between persistence engines, like ETL only not stodgy

    ...Transporter allows the user to configure a number of data adaptors as sources or sinks. These can be databases, files or other resources. Data is read from the sources, converted into a message format, and then send down to the sink where the message is converted into a writable format for its destination. The user can also create data transformations in JavaScript which can sit between the source and sink and manipulate or filter the message flow. Adaptors may be able to track changes as they happen in source data. This "tail" capability allows a Transporter to stay running and keep the sinks in sync.

    rtlamr

    rtlamr

    An rtl-sdr receiver for Itron ERT compatible smart meters

    Utilities often use "smart meters" to optimize their residential meter reading infrastructure. Smart meters transmit consumption information in the various ISM bands allowing utilities to simply send readers driving through neighborhoods to collect commodity consumption information. One protocol in particular: Encoder Receiver Transmitter by Itron is fairly straightforward to decode and operates in the 900MHz ISM band, well within the tunable range of inexpensive rtl-sdr dongles. This project is a software-defined radio receiver for these messages. ...
